Analysis
Finland recorded 114.21 Index for annual household final consumption expenditure of durable goods and in 2024. That is the highest value across all 50 years on record.
The figure is up 1.0% on the previous year and up 19.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, annual household final consumption expenditure of durable goods and in Finland peaked at 114.21 Index in 2024 and was at its lowest, 20.19 Index, in 1975.
Finland ranks 18th of 27 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 50 years of available data.

About this data
This table shows breakdowns of household final consumption expenditure on durable goods, semi-durable goods, non-durable goods, and services. Durable goods are defined as goods that can be used repeatedly or continuously over a period of considerably more than one year and have a substantially higher purchasers’ price than semi-durable goods and non-durable goods. Non-durable goods can only be used once or have a lifetime of considerably less than one year. Semi-durable goods differ from non-durable goods in that they can be used repeatedly or continuously over a period longer than a year and they differ from durable goods in that their expected lifetime of use, though longer than a year, is often significantly shorter and their purchasers’ price is substantially less.
